Physiology vs. Psychology: Know the Difference

Shumaila Saeed
By Shumaila Saeed || Updated on December 29, 2023
Physiology studies the functions and mechanisms of living organisms, while psychology focuses on the human mind, behavior, and mental processes.
Physiology vs. Psychology

Key Differences

Physiology deals with how the physical and chemical functions of organisms operate, including humans. Psychology, on the other hand, explores human behavior, emotions, and mental processes.
